"Superficie Blu" (1979) is a minimalist work by Italian artist Enrico Castellani, known for his exploration of surface and texture in painting. The piece features a grid of indentations that disrupt the flatness of the blue canvas, inviting viewers to reconsider the relationship between the surface and the space it occupies. Castellani's work challenges traditional understandings of painting by focusing on the physicality of the medium. His signature style is characterized by the use of geometric forms and the manipulation of the canvas to create subtle variations in light and shadow, imbuing the seemingly simple forms with a sense of depth and dynamism.
